Damascus-SANA
The Minister of Internal Trade and Consumer Protection, Dr. Amr Salem, affirmed that work is underway to achieve a significant decrease in the prices of basic materials and commodities after two months in the markets, through their availability in abundance and ensuring their continuous flow.
Regarding the amount of direct sugar via the electronic card, Minister Salem, in his response to a SANA reporter’s question during a press interview held today at Al Wahda Foundation for Press and Publication, pointed out that the amount of direct sugar will be increased from 2 kilograms to 4 kilograms next week, explaining that it is possible to register on the quantity again.
Regarding stopping the sale of oil via the card, Minister Salem stated that the reason for this was the lack of sufficient supplies of the substance and work was being done to collect sufficient quantities to be put up again.
Minister Salem revealed that there are more types of basic materials that will be added through the card in the halls of the Syrian Trade Corporation, at prices well lower than the market, pointing out that there is a feasible way to provide support to the beneficiaries that is currently being studied in the government.
Minister Salem indicated that work is underway to allocate a number of cars that have shelves to transport the bundles of bread from the bakery to the accredited to ensure that the material reaches the citizens in good quality to the sales centers, including groceries, to which other materials will be added such as water and others, because there is no large financial return from selling bread .
Regarding the rise in poultry prices, Minister Salem explained that there is a segment that is the main reason for raising prices, “the owners of slaughterhouses and brokers,” most of them are exploiters and we will not tolerate them at all.
